Course details

Embedded Systems Design

NVD Acad. year 2010/2011 Summer semester

Current academic year

Guarantor

Language of instruction

Czech

Completion

Examination

Time span

  • 26 hrs lectures

Department

Study literature

  • Cheng A.M.K.: Real-Time Systems -- Scheduling, Analysis, and Verification. Wiley, 2002.
  • Berger A.S.: Embedded Systems Design -- An Introduction to Processes, Tools, and Techniques. CMP Books, 2002. 
  • Kreowski H.-J., Montanari U., Orejas F., Rozenberg G., Taentzer G.: Formal Methods in Software and Systems Modeling. Springer, LNCS 3393, 2005.
  • Schneider K.: Verification of Reactive Systems -- Formal Methods and Algorithms. Springer-Verlag, 2004.
  • Huth M.R.A., Ryan M.D.: Logic in Computer Science -- Modelling and Reasoning about Systems. Cambridge University Press, 2000.
  • de Bakker J.W. et all. (Editors): Real-Time: Theory in Practice. Springer-Verlag, LNCS 600, 1992.

Fundamental literature

  • Cheng A.M.K.: Real-Time Systems -- Scheduling, Analysis, and Verification. Wiley, 2002.
  • Berger A.S.: Embedded Systems Design -- An Introduction to Processes, Tools, and Techniques. CMP Books, 2002. 
  • Kreowski H.-J., Montanari U., Orejas F., Rozenberg G., Taentzer G.: Formal Methods in Software and Systems Modeling. Springer, LNCS 3393, 2005.
  • Schneider K.: Verification of Reactive Systems -- Formal Methods and Algorithms. Springer-Verlag, 2004.
  • Huth M.R.A., Ryan M.D.: Logic in Computer Science -- Modelling and Reasoning about Systems. Cambridge University Press, 2000.
  • de Bakker J.W. et all. (Editors): Real-Time: Theory in Practice. Springer-Verlag, LNCS 600, 1992.

Syllabus of lectures

  1. Embedded distributed system design principles
  2. Embedded system design life cycle
  3. Embedded system components networking
  4. Behavioral specifications - reactive and real-time
  5. Architectural specifications
  6. Structured design
  7. Object-oriented design
  8. Design frameworks
  9. Specifiation frameworks
  10. Embedded systems on Internet
  11. Wired and wireless networks
  12. Development tools and environments
  13. Case studies - smart sensor networks

Course inclusion in study plans

  • Programme VTI-DR-4, field DVI4, any year of study, Elective
  • Programme VTI-DR-4, field DVI4, any year of study, Elective
Back to top